I applied online. The process took 2 weeks. I interviewed at J.P. Morgan in Sep 2008
Interview
Initially was called by a recruiter who conducted a phone interview with standard questions concerning my experiences with customer service. Then I was scheduled for an in-person interview with the Branch Manager and his assistant. They were both very friendly and listened very attentively. It was only a few days after the interview when I received an offer. I had to go downtown to fill out paperwork and get instructions on when and where to take my drug screening. The following week I did my first day of training. There's 3 days of training at a computer located at your branch and three days of classroom training at a location downtown.
